Early symptoms of depression in children include the following: 1. ** In terms of emotions ** - Low Mood: Feeling depressed, sad, and depressed for a long time. You need to pay special attention to low moods that last for more than two weeks. You may even experience extreme world-weariness and be unable to obtain happiness from normal activities. - Emotional fluctuations: sometimes low, sad, silent, sometimes suddenly become irritable, irritable, easy to lose temper when encountering bad things, teenagers may have more intense emotional fluctuations, often suddenly from happy to low or angry. - [Loss of happiness: Being in a depressed state for a long time, unable to communicate with others normally, and unable to be interested in the people and things around you.] 2. ** Interested ** - Decline of interest: No longer interested in anything, losing enthusiasm for previous hobbies, losing interest in daily activities (such as sports, socializing, games, hobbies, etc.), no longer having the motivation and enthusiasm to participate. 3. ** In terms of social interaction ** - Reduce or resist social activities: unwilling to contact others, reduce communication with friends and family, become more withdrawn and silent, avoid communication with family and friends, avoid social activities, reduce participation in daily activities such as family and school, and even give up school or other important tasks. 4. ** Physical aspects ** - Sleep problems: Difficulty falling asleep, early waking up, insomnia, or drowsiness may occur. - Dieting problems: There may be loss of appetite, loss of interest in food, weight loss, or increased appetite and binge eating. - Other physical discomfort: physical discomfort, dizziness, chest tightness, nausea, limb weakness, headache, stomach pain, etc. These symptoms have no obvious physiological reasons but may appear frequently. 5. ** In terms of self-awareness ** - Self-denial: Often belittling oneself, lacking confidence in one's own abilities, frequently showing inferiority or disappointment in oneself, thinking that one can't do things well, and even losing confidence in the future. Thinking about problems tends to be negative, pessimistic, and often feels hopeless. - Attention and learning difficulties: Difficulties in learning and concentration, such as decline in academic performance, memory loss, lack of concentration, etc., may also cause a decline in learning motivation, slow thinking, or even complete loss of motivation to learn, resulting in frequent truancy. 6. ** Other aspects ** - Self-harm tendency: It is possible to have thoughts and behaviors that harm oneself to relieve inner pain and relieve suppressed emotions, such as repeated scratches, cuts, burns, etc., and the wounds do not conform to common accidents. It will also prevent others from seeing traces of self-harm. - Suicide-related situations may occur: directly talking about death or suicide, suddenly becoming calm from extreme depression, alienating others, researching suicide methods, places, and tools, and implementing suicide plans. - Over-sensitivity: Extremely sensitive to external evaluations or peer opinions, easily feeling neglected and ostracized, which in turn aggravate inferiority and loneliness. - Rebellious behavior: Relieve stress by rebelling and defying parents and teachers. As stress increases, you may seek extreme ways to escape pain, such as abusing drugs, alcohol, or participating in other dangerous activities. - Internet addiction: Long-term addiction to social media, video games, videos, and other online activities, escaping real difficulties and stress through the virtual world.
